flourish

US /ˈflɝː.ɪʃ/
UK /ˈflɝː.ɪʃ/
"flourish" picture

Verb

1.

grow or develop in a healthy or vigorous way, especially as the result of a particularly favorable environment.

Example:
The plants flourish in warm, humid climates.
A new business can flourish in this economic environment.
2.

wave (something) around to attract attention.

Example:
The conductor flourished his baton.
He flourished the sword dramatically.

Noun

1.

a bold or extravagant gesture or action made to attract attention.

Example:
He made a grand flourish with his cape.
The magician ended his trick with a dramatic flourish.
2.

a short, showy piece of music played on brass instruments.

Example:
The trumpet played a triumphant flourish.
The ceremony began with a musical flourish.
